Let me put it in easier to understand words. Basically, all the tuning parts replace objects from the original GTA SA game and all of them have their unique ID. That is the reason why it is hard to add the rims, in addition to what Arunn already said. Also there are already a lot of rims that are likely to be available in the close future and I am confident that the players would much rather those irl rims to the stock GTA ones that btw are not colorable.
